The 131st Constitutional Amendment Bill, which sought to expand Lok Sabha seats to 850, failed in Parliament, ensuring the delimitation freeze remains in force until the 2026 Census results are fully processed.
| Fact / Entity | Detail |
|---|---|
| What | Failure of 131st Constitutional Amendment Bill in Parliament |
| When | May 2026 |
| Who | Parliament of India |
| Constitutional Articles | Article 81 (Composition of Lok Sabha); Article 82 (Readjustment after census) |
| Key Outcome | Delimitation freeze maintained; current 543-seat allocation continues |
| Proposed Target | Expansion of Lok Sabha to 850 seats |
| Significance | Defers resolution of North-South representation imbalance |
